超深大直径旋挖桩水下混凝土灌注工艺研究  被引量:15

Study on underwater concrete pouring technology of large diameter and large depth cast-in-place piles

摘  要:在地质条件复杂的深厚海域回填区域,超深大直径旋挖钻孔灌注桩面临成孔难度大、水下混凝土灌注施工风险高的难点。水下混凝土灌注需要综合考虑混凝土质量、料斗容量、导管直径、导管埋置深度、孔底沉渣、泥浆比重、灌注标高等多方面因素。依托工程实践,就超深大直径旋挖桩水下混凝土灌注施工过程的质量控制进行了探索及总结,为同类工程提供了施工经验。In the backfilling area of deep sea area with complex geological conditions, ultra deep and large-diameter rotary drilling cast-in-place pile faces the difficulties of hole forming and high risk of underwater concrete pouring construction, so it is necessary to comprehensively consider the factors such as concrete quality, hopper capacity, conduit diameter, conduit embedding depth, hole bottom sediment, mud specific ravity, perfusion elevation, etc.. Combined with engineering examples, this paper comprehensively expounds the quality control of underwater concrete pouring construction process in the construction process of large diameter and deep rotary excavation piles, and provides construction experience for similar projects.
